当配置一个客户端连接到具有由私人 CA 签署的服务证书的 TLS 服务器时,你需要向客户端提供 CA 证书,以便它验证服务器。 dnsNames字段指定了与证书相关的 SAN[1] 的列表。...CertificateRequest的spec内的所有字段,以及任何管理的 cert-manager 注释,都是不可改变的,创建后不能修改。...这组值和含义如下: Ready Reason 条件含义 False Pending CertificateRequest目前正处于等待状态,等待其他操作的发生。...关于 ACME 订单和域名验证的更多细节可以在 Let's Encrypt 网站 这里[5] 找到。...接受认证后的最终状态将被复制到 challenge 的status.state 字段,如果 ACME 服务器试图验证 challenge 时发生错误,也会复制 "error reason(错误原因)"。
企业级状态管理四大需求多环境适配:开发/测试/预发/生产环境需独立状态标识角色权限隔离:产品经理标注"需求变更" vs 测试标记"阻塞风险"自定义工作流:金融行业特有的"合规审核中"状态可视化看板:用不同色块区分优先级...(红-紧急/黄-常规/绿-归档)三大工具横评实验实验组A:Apifox现状:强制使用预制十种状态模型(设计中/待开发/开发中/已废弃/联调中/测试中/已测完/已发布/将废弃/有异常)致命缺陷:无法添加"...法务审核"等定制状态状态流转需全员强制同步,导致历史记录混乱状态看板无法按业务线筛选实验组B:Postman进阶能力:通过脚本模拟自定义状态实操成本:需编写Pre-request Script添加虚拟字段状态变更无法触发...(开发者/测试/产品等)智能流转规则:undefined设置状态间转换条件(如:仅测试组长可将"预发布"改为"生产就绪")→ 配置自动化动作真实案例演示:undefined某车联网企业用Apipost实现...这仅仅是接口管理革命的冰山一角—— 后续也会做更多内容,敬请关注。
段不变性还意味着文档更新的功能相同:当文档“更新”时,它实际上被标记为已删除并替换为具有适当字段更改的新文档。...这个查询有很多选项可供使用,所以更准确的例子就是说你一直在跟踪月食数据,现在想要添加日食。..._source.phenomenon = 'lunar_eclipse'" } }' 为了解决这个问题,脚本正在更改与特定值匹配的现有字段的值。...脚本还可用于修改字段或执行更复杂的操作,例如,如果要添加具有默认值的不存在的字段,然后根据一系列条件更新现有值。...那么,如果您需要将先前定义为整数的字段更新为字符串,会发生什么?你猜对了:映射冲突。 那么如何解决这些映射冲突呢?重新编制。在后一种情况下,您应该在需要更新现有字段定义时重新索引数据。为什么?
鸿蒙应用开发从入门到入行第七天 - http网络请求导读:在本篇文章里,您将掌握鸿蒙开发工具DevEco的基本使用、ArkUI里的基础组件,并通过制作一个简单界面掌握使用HarmonyOS - 网络请求概述在应用开发中,少不了需要向云端发送请求进行交互...网络连接管理网络连接管理提供管理网络一些基础能力,包括WiFi/蜂窝/Ethernet等多网络连接优先级管理、网络质量评估、订阅默认/指定网络连接状态变化、查询网络连接信息、DNS解析等功能。...MDNSMDNS即多播DNS(Multicast DNS),提供局域网内的本地服务添加、移除、发现、解析等能力。...是可选的(这两个一个上架审核要用,一个对权限做更细致场景划分,目前我们暂时不用)我们目前仅需申请网络请求权限,因此做如下配置(技巧:随便输入内容关键字,DevEco都有提示,按回车即可) "requestPermissions...header字段 header: [{ // 例如指定请求体类型 'Content-Type': 'application/json' }], // 请求携带的参数
手机应用发起碰一碰分享时,双端设备需要在亮屏、解锁的状态下并且都已开启华为分享服务(系统默认开启),设备顶部轻碰即可触发。...当分享数据为文件、图片等无需添加标题及描述的场景,推荐使用此卡片模板。 使用方法: 构造分享数据时,仅传递预览图(thumbnailUri)字段,即可生成此卡片模板。...当分享数据为链接类型时,需要向用户传递链接的内容,推荐使用此卡片模板。...使用方法: 需同时满足以下2个条件: 构造分享数据时,需同时传入标题(title)、描述(description)字段和预览图(thumbnailUri)字段。 预览图宽高比小于1:1。...使用方法: 需同时满足以下2个条件: 构造分享数据时,需同时传入标题(title)、描述(description)字段和预览图(thumbnailUri)字段。 预览图宽高比大于1:1。
一、先看报错"reason"=>"failed to parse field [status] of type [integer] in document with id '469716694017769472...Preview of field's value: 'false'"图片图为用户将字段类型改为 keyword 后的结果,起初ES索引status类型为 integer二、分析原因检查原始数据,是否统一为数值类型...ES索引字段类型映射异常以上怀疑的两点,均未发现任何异常,目标索引替换成一个新的索引名字后,依然报同样的错误。...于是乎,怀疑logstash同步MySQL的tinyint类型字段本身就存在异常,经过一番排查,终于找到了解决方案。...三、解决方案# jdbc 连接串后面添加参数 tinyInt1isBit=false 即可jdbc_connection_string => "jdbc:mysql://$URL/$DATABASE?
只读模式待磁盘空间充裕后,需要人工解除。 因此,监视集群中的可用存储空间至关重要。 3、已删除的文档 Elasticsearch中的文档无法修改,并且是不可变的(immutable)。...Elasticsearch 执行的删除或更新文档操作会先将文档标记为已删除(逻辑删除),不会立即将其从Elasticsearch中物理删除。当你继续索引更多数据时,这些文档将在后台被清理。...如果主要目标是调整摄取速度的索引,则可以将 Elasticsearch 的默认刷新间隔从1秒更改为30秒。30秒后,这将使文档可见以供搜索,从而优化索引速度。...如下示例,可以将 cont 字段的 index 属性值设置为 false,这样,cont 字段将不会被搜索。...通过在集群中添加数据节点并增加副本分片数量来提升集群的高可用性。 搜索查询必须命中每个分片(主分片或者副本分片),因此分片过多会使搜索变慢。 慢查询和索引日志可用来解决搜索和索引性能问题。
,还有表和字段之间的关系。...,会报错 解决方案 在 service file的开头添加以下 两行 即修改完善后的代码如下: #!...(1)安装目录下的config中的startup.options需要修改 修改主要项: 1.服务默认启动用户和用户组为logstash;可以修改为root; 2....:systemctl status logstash 问题 4.2 安装logstash服务需先安装jdk 报错提示如下: 通过查看jave版本,验证是否已安装 上图说明没有安装。...添加个专门的账号 useradd qqweixinkibaba --添加账号 chown -R qqweixinkibaba:hzdbakibaba kibana-7.4.2-linux-x86_64
如果报文结构简单还好,如果有一百个甚至更多的字段,怎么办?毫不夸张,在实际工作中,我遇到过一个银行核心接口有140多个字段的情况,而且这还不是最多的!...把接口类修改为这样的结构(标红的部分是新增或修改): [1573612151350028840.png] [1573612156641052018.png] setterMap就是缓存字段setter的...如果增加更多的键值对(不存在对应字段),性能下降更严重。 所以必须进一步完善优化代码。为了加以区分,我们把之前的优化代码称为V1版;进一步完善的代码称为V2版。 怎么完善?...继续沿用前面的例子,分析改进后的代码的工作流程: 1)第一次执行initialize()函数,实例的状态是这样变化的: [1573612214943056863.png] 因为fieldX和fieldY...3)因为取消了ignoreMap,取消了V2版判断字段是否应该被忽略的逻辑,代码更简洁,也能节约一部分资源。
只提示一个字段的含义:unassigned.reason 未分配分片的原因,返回值包括: ALLOCATION_FAILED:由于分片分配失败而未分配。...REPLICA_ADDED:由于显式添加副本而未分配。 REROUTE_CANCELLED:由于显式取消重新路由命令而未分配。...通过未分配列原因unassigned.reason似乎是已经够详细了,但是有时候我们需要更多细节,特别是如果我们有节点路由或其他更复杂的问题。...,每个问题都需要特别注意或解决,或者在许多情况下,需要重新导入数据解决。...3、小结 之前也写过集群红色、黄色修复方案的文章,这次的更系统化一些,更偏方法论。
因此,它提供了一种更简单、更可靠的与远程服务交互的方式。...毕竟,我们希望确保服务已注册,并且当前可用。 在这里,使用 Hydra 的 makeAPIRequest 方法变得更容易且更不容易出错。...您的服务可以通过将侦听器添加到已加载的 hydra 实例来接收消息。下面的示例演示了如何在必要时制定响应。...message.priority = 'high'; message.type = 'service:control'; 需要注意的是,我们可以将优先级(priority)和类型(type)字段添加到传递给...如果该字段包含文本,但不是有效的IP地址,则 hydra 假定您已指定 DNS 名称。 Hydra 启动时,它将查看所有可用的网络接口。启动 Hydra-router 时,我们可以看到这一点。
集群管理计算节点集群集群管理主要为用户提供对计算节点集群的部署、添加、启停监控、删除等管理操作。集群管理记录集群管理页面显示已部署或已添加的计算节点集群信息。...高可用组件:在主备节点模式的集群中该字段主要展示Keepalived组件运行状态,在多节点模式的集群中展示LVS组件运行状态;同时会展示LVS的虚拟IP地址(VIP)。...集群添加:为管理平台手动添加计算节点集群(计算节点已在线下完成部署)信息。更多->开启监控:对已停止监控的计算节点集群(集群名称为红色背景显示)进行重新开启监控。...更多->停止监控:对正在监控的计算节点集群停止监控,则管理平台不再对该集群进行状态监控,停止监控的集群用户登录普通用户角色页面时无法查看。更多->删除集群:对页面中已管理的计算节点集群进行删除。...页面自动勾选“切换完自动重建高可用环境”,即切换完成后程序自动重建环境。无需人工再次重建即可满足下一次高可用切换操作。若出现执行失败则需要人工介入查看问题并解决。
文章工具(4)——允许客服人员找到知识库文章帮助他们解决Case,然后将文章关联到Case或通过邮件发送给客户。 ?...自定义按钮和链接(8)—可以让客服使用更多的工具和自定义功能。...例如我们希望在log a call的时候显示更多字段可进行如下操作: 1. 编辑Case布局,在页面布局编辑器顶部点击Feed View ?...2.在Log a Call Action fields中添加Case number, Case Origin,Case Owner和Case Reason字段 ?...3.点击保存并进入Case Feed的log a Call标签中,我们可在底部发现我们自定义添加的字段 ? 同理,我们也可编辑其他标签中的字段,但是需要注意的是,如果加载字段过多会拖慢访问的速度。
完成功能定义后,系统将自动生成该产品的物模型。 新建产品后可以引用已存在的物模型模板,也可以自定义物模型。 物模型类型包含三元素:属性、事件和行为。...可添加多个输出参数,例如环境传感器检测到空气质量很差,空调异常告警等。 EventId 行为 用于实现更复杂的业务逻辑,可添加多个调用参数和返回参数。...行为的输入参数和输出参数可添加属性中六种基本数据类型,用于让设备执行某项特定的任务。例如,开锁动作需要知道是哪个用户在什么时间开锁,锁的状态如何等。...设备属性上报 当设备需要向云端上报设备运行状态的变化时,以通知云端业务系统接收设备上报属性数据, 设备上报主题:/up/property/{ProductID}/{DeviceSN} 设备上报: {...子设备管理 子设备身份注册后,需由网关向物联网平台上报网关与子设备的拓扑关系,然后进行子设备上线。 子设备上线过程中,物联网平台会校验子设备的身份和与网关的拓扑关系。
Elasticsearch实战:常见错误及详细解决方案1.read_only_allow_delete":"true"当我们在向某个索引添加一条数据的时候,可能(极少情况)会碰到下面的报错:{ "error...如上示例中,我们添加第一篇文档时(z1索引不存在),elasticsearch会自动的创建索引,然后为age字段创建映射关系(es 就猜此时age字段的值是什么类型,如果发现是text类型,那么存储该字段的映射类型就是...解决办法就是:如果选择动态创建一篇文档,映射关系取决于你添加的第一条文档的各字段都对应什么类型。而不是我们看到的那样,第一次是text,第二次不加引号,就是long类型了不是这样的。...如果嫌弃上面的解决办法麻烦,那就选择手动创建映射关系。首先指定好各字段对应什么类型。后续才不至于出错。...4.持续更新中更多优质内容请关注公号:汀丶人工智能;会提供一些相关的资源和优质文章,免费获取阅读。
,其状态已更改为Joining。...ClusterEvent.MemberUp,新成员已加入集群,其状态已更改为Up。 ClusterEvent.MemberExited,某个成员正在离开集群,其状态已更改为Exiting。...如何清理 Removed 状态的成员 你可以在registerOnMemberRemoved回调中进行一些清理,当当前成员状态更改为Removed或群集已关闭时,将调用该回调。...注释:在已关闭的群集上注册OnMemberRemoved回调,该回调将立即在调用方线程上调用,否则稍后当当前成员状态更改为Removed时将调用该回调。...相反,高阈值产生的错误更少,但需要更多的时间来检测实际的崩溃。默认阈值为8,适用于大多数情况。然而,在云环境中,例如 Amazon EC2,为了解决此类平台上有时出现的网络问题,其值可以增加到12。
Elasticsearch的索引阻塞功能在早期版本中就已存在,用于管理对索引的访问和操作。随着 Elasticsearch 版本的更新,该功能也在不断得到改进和扩展。...所谓的元数据,可以理解为索引的基本信息和设置,比如索引包含哪些字段,这些字段是什么类型的等等。...这些阻塞可以通过动态索引设置添加或移除,也可以通过专门的API来添加,这样做的好处是能确保在添加写入阻塞后,所有索引的分片都正确地应用了阻塞,比如确保在添加写入阻塞后,所有正在进行的写入操作都已完成。...index.blocks.read_only_allow_delete 类似于index.blocks.write,但也允许删除索引以释放更多资源。磁盘基础的分片分配器可能会自动添加和移除这个阻塞。...GET test/_search { "query": { "match_all": {} } } 4、解除设置 API 要解除已经设置的索引阻塞,可以将相应的阻塞设置修改为false
整理好数据后,保存为.json或者.jsonl文件,然后放入目录中的data/文件夹中。...例如, 我们的原始指令微调文件为:data/ 文件夹下的 simple_math_4op.json 文件 输入字段为q,输出字段为a 希望经过 tokenize 之后保存到 data/tokenized_data..."} {"ORG": "视觉中国", "sentiment": "中性", "reason": "称ChatGPT对公司业务暂无影响,还在观望状态"} {"ORG": "亚牛逊", "sentiment...{"ORG": "艾里", "sentiment": "中性", "reason": "大型图片供应商视觉中国称ChatGPT对公司业务暂无影响,还在观望状态。"}...,还在观望状态"} {"ORG": "亚牛逊", "sentiment": "中性", "reason": "关于AIGC的表态"} {"ORG": "巨硬", "sentiment": "中性", "
有时候你会遇到过官员踢球推责,你的问题在我这里能解决就解决,不能解决就推卸给另外个一个部门(对象)。至于到底谁来解决这个问题呢?...它们仅需保持一个指向其后继者的引用,而不需保持它所有的候选接受者的引用。...3) 增强了给对象指派职责( R e s p o n s i b i l i t y )的灵活性 :当在对象中分派职责时,职责链给你更多的灵活性。...也是个不纯的职责链,因为每个对象可能处理一部分后,就需要传给下个对象来处理。 <?...php /** * 加入在公司里,如果你的请假时间小于0.5天,那么只需要向leader打声招呼就OK了。
DataX Sqoop 运行模式 单进程多线程 MR MySQL读写 单机压力大;读写粒度容易控制 mr模式重,写出错处理麻烦 Hive读写 单机压力大 很好 文件格式 orc支持 orc不支持,可添加...3.2 执行器设计 为了与已有的数据平台交互,需要做一些定制修改: 符合平台规则的状态上报,如启动/运行中/结束,运行时需上报进度,结束需上报成功失败 符合平台规则的运行日志实时上报,用于展示 统计、校验...如果 MySQL 配置字段与 Hive 实际结构不一致,则把 Hive 表 drop 掉后重建。表重建可能带来下游 Hive SQL 出错的风险,这个靠 SQL 的定时检查规避。...这里有坑,Hive 没有无符号类型,注意 MySQL 的 int unsigned 的取值范围,需要向上转型,转为 Hive 的 bigint;同理,MySQL 的 bigint unsigned 也需要向上转型...原生的 hdfsreader 读取超大 orc 文件有 bug,orc 的读 api 会把大文件分片成多份,默认大于256MB会分片,而 datax 仅读取了第一个分片,修改为读取所有分片解决问题。
领取专属 10元无门槛券
手把手带您无忧上云